Output 3ccbf6da72738373c0a5d38f92a2e6b6c28687747c4be4bc5883f4977b4f20be:3

value
182027564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e88ab7f45d623637cf023bc4dd17ed4aedb11b8 OP_EQUAL
address
MHycHXK1Rd1eAju5DjH8uk9KMhkgfRsVUV
transaction
3ccbf6da72738373c0a5d38f92a2e6b6c28687747c4be4bc5883f4977b4f20be
spent
true